The TurboMist™ distributes moisture via a rotating foam system
powered by air movement in the furnace plenum. The foam pick
up water carried in the unit and disperse moisture into the air.

Page 4 MAINTENANCE Your Field TurboMist™ Humidifier puts pure water in the air and traps impurities on the evaporator discs and in the water pan. At the end of each heating season the water pan and float should be cleaned and the saddle valve turned off. Do not use sharp objects or harsh abrasives t...
